Waterford Libraries and staff are deeply saddened at the passing of travel writer and independent spirit, Dervla Murphy.
“As Mayor of Waterford City and County, I am saddened to hear of Dervla Murphy’s passing and extend my condolences to her daughter, grandchildren and many friends.
Dervla was Ireland’s most famous travel writer and a native of Lismore, Co Waterford. During her ninety years Dervla travelled across continents, wrote over 25 travel books and famously documented her six-month journey through Europe, Afghanistan, Pakistan and India on a bike in Full Tilt: Ireland to India with a Bicycle in 1965.
Waterford has lost an icon, a trailblazer, an intrepid adventurer and a woman who was ahead of her time.
Ar dheis Dé go raibh a hanam”
Mayor of Waterford City and County, Cllr. Joe Kelly
